Transaction 856e7ce9f741009478066af6867e841a014be7b573e7fbae17cfc1abb6e139ab

1 Input
2 Outputs
  • 856e7ce9f741009478066af6867e841a014be7b573e7fbae17cfc1abb6e139ab:0
  • value  174000
    address  3M6DPHJVLFEocwdJZJJtw2KvAn28BQATtE
  • 856e7ce9f741009478066af6867e841a014be7b573e7fbae17cfc1abb6e139ab:1
  • value  4681344
    address  12L32pNG7Vg7rjaCHVGEmnJSyCSemnWvnk